🌱 What it is

Wheat germ oil is a cold-pressed oil from the germ of the wheat kernel, rich in vitamin E and healthy fats.

✨ Why it's good for you

  • Supports heart health
  • May help support healthy cholesterol levels
  • Rich source of vitamin E

🥄 How to use it

Add a spoonful or two to food after cooking (never heat or cook with it, as heat destroys its beneficial compounds).

How much: 1-2 teaspoons daily added to food after cooking.

Why it works: Rich in vitamin E and other nutrients that may support healthy circulation and cholesterol levels.

⚠️ Cautions

  • Never heat or cook with wheat germ oil — heat destroys its nutrients and can create harmful compounds.
  • People with wheat allergy or gluten sensitivity should avoid it.
  • Consult a doctor before use if you have a heart condition or take heart medication.
